Abstract
Kaposi’s sarcoma (KS) is an angioproliferative disease, with a viral etiology and a multifactorial pathogenesis that depends on an immune dysfunction. It is divided into four types according to the aetiology. There was no randomized controlled trials due to very rare disease. Thus clinical guidelines has not been established properly. This review summarized epidemiology, risk factor, and recent treatment strategies in Kaposi sarcoma patients.
